Evening, brewing this as I missed out at the Weekend:

( FM-SMIFF )
3 kg Lager malt
1kg Flaked Maize
250gms of Marshmallows @15min
10gms Pacific Gem 14.6% @ 60min
30gms Bobeck 5.2% @ 15min
250gms Granulated Sugar

Gave me 1054

W34/70 Yeast

Mash went:
40º 20mins
50º 20mins
66º 40mins
Boil Now on
Chilling
